“…Early northern blot studies revealed readily detectable basal levels of fra-2 in whole mouse brain homogenates, contrasting with the much lower basal expression of other members of the fos family (including c-fos, fra-1, fra-2, and fosB) (Foletta et al, 1994). fra-2 mRNA expression, as detected by in situ hybridization, has only been described for the hippocampus (Beer et al, 1998), and the suprachiasmatic (SCN) and paraventricular nuclei (PVN) of the hypothalamus (Honkaniemi et al, 1994, Schwartz et al, 2000.…”
